The "Ultra Solid Reactor" is a sludge high-speed reaction solidification device newly developed by engineers who have been engaged in solidification processing equipment for over 20 years, pursuing economic efficiency. It sends warm air from an electric hot air blower to set the temperature inside the device to one suitable for reactions. The hydration reaction between sludge and solidifying agents becomes significantly more active compared to room temperature processing, allowing for a reduction in the addition rate of solidifying agents while still enabling discharge in a dry state, thereby lowering the running costs of the solidifying agents. Automatic adjustment of the addition rate of solidifying agents is also possible, achieving simple and economical solidification processing. Our company is small, but we have applied for patents for electric dust collectors and sludge solidification treatment devices. Currently, we are providing environmental purification technology consulting based on cutting-edge environmental purification technologies, and we are involved in the development and planning of environmental purification devices. We have also developed and are selling environmental purification products, including the dioxin removal coagulant Ultra Separate SDS, the heavy metal removal coagulant Ultra Separate S300, and the turbidity coagulant Ultra Separate MC, which is effective for a wide range of applications from organic wastewater treatment to the purification of lake water quality. Additionally, we are currently selling a dihydrate gypsum semi-hydration device that can convert waste gypsum boards after crushing and separation into recyclable raw materials. We are also developing solidifying agents for soil conditioners, high-moisture sludge, and heavy metal-containing sludge using the semi-hydrated gypsum produced from the dihydrate gypsum semi-hydration device, and we plan to sell these as well.
